The Murmetta consent banner ships as a standalone edge bundle and must be rolled out region by region, never globally in one push. Start with the Lowvale staging pool, confirm that banner impressions and consent writes appear in the audit stream, then promote to each production region in sequence, waiting at least one hour between promotions. If consent write latency exceeds the alert threshold, halt and roll back the most recent region only. Before your first deploy, set the following configuration values in the release manifest.

service settings:
pelael:
  pin: 8392
  tenant: kelax
  seal: seal_aea03c1c
  metrics_host: metrics.pelael.braskforge.internal
  standby_team: wenys
  escalation: ulaius-silmir
  nonce: c9c43f

**Q: A guest needs Wi-Fi — what do I do?** Easy one. Send them to the little Wi-Fi desk at Norbeck House reception (the counter with the green lamp). They'll get a day voucher printed there; assistants can pre-book vouchers for meetings of six or more via the Hollypoint portal. Vouchers expire at midnight, no exceptions. If the desk is unstaffed — lunchtimes, mostly — you can print vouchers yourself from the terminal after unlocking it with the code below.

door code, yagap-bahof: bdg-O-05

Hey — quick handover before I'm off. The Pulsewrap rollout is mid-flight: zstd compression is enabled on two telemetry shards, six to go. Watch for payload-size alerts; they're expected to drop, not spike. Rollback toggle is in the usual config repo. If anything looks off overnight, reach the Pulsewrap leads here.

escalation mailbox, bafog-fafog: ulador@paliqlabs.internal

# Limits & Quotas: Payroll Export v3 (Ledgerbird)

The v3 payroll export moves from a single monolithic file to chunked encrypted segments, which changes our quota story. Each segment is independently signed, and the exporter enforces per-tenant caps on segment count and total payload size to prevent resource exhaustion via oversized runs. Retention of intermediate segments is fixed at 24 hours. The enforced constants are listed below for audit purposes.

tuning table, yajog-yahof:
BUDGETS = {
    "lamvan": 303,
    "wenox": 460,
    "fenvan": 525,
}